Team culture, at its core, refers to the shared values, beliefs, behaviors, and norms that shape how members of a team interact, collaborate, and approach their work. It's the collective personality of a team, influencing everything from communication styles and decision-making processes to how conflicts are resolved and successes are celebrated. Understanding and intentionally shaping team culture can be a powerful driver of engagement, productivity, and overall organizational success.
